Description From the respected and twenty-year-established collection of the Online Titanic Museum and TitanicRelics comes an exclusive opportunity - the ability to own an affordable and 100% verified authentic relic from the most famous shipwreck in the world; the RMS Titanic.Immediately following the sinking of Titanic on April 15th, 1912, the White Star Line chartered several ships and tasked them with recovering the victims of the disaster. One such ship was the cable ship C.S. Minia based out of Halifax, N.S.Each trading card features an incredibly rare seat cane fragment removed from the remains of a damaged Titanic deck chair that was recovered from the scene of the sinking by an officer of the Minia and kept in his family for many years until it was passed on to the now defunct Manitoba Museum of the Titanic before ultimately entering our world-class collection of Titanic artifacts.Each trading card is professionally printed on super-thick 16pt UV coated card-stock, and is secured in an 5" x 3" archival lucite screwcase for safety and display.
